Iron Mountain is seeking a strategic and analytical Senior Benefits Analyst to join our Total Rewards Center of Excellence team.

In this role, you will be responsible for serving as the North American subject matter expert for retirement, life, disability, and time off programs. You will drive the strategic design, regulatory governance, vendor negotiation, and compliance of these programs within a highly collaborative, matrixed environment.

You will partner closely with a dedicated group of Total Rewards, Human Resources Service Delivery, and Employee Relations professionals to deliver market-competitive benefit solutions that enhance employee engagement and support overall business objectives.

What You’ll Do

In this role, you will:

  • Benefit & Policy Design: Develop competitive design and communication recommendations for United States and Canada retirement, life, disability, and time off programs utilizing market benchmarking and data analytics.
  • Vendor & Renewal Management: Partner with senior leadership and external brokers on strategic vendor management, renewal negotiations, and roadmap recommendations to support evolving business needs.
  • Compliance & Governance Oversight: Monitor federal, state, and provincial legislative changes to ensure strict regulatory compliance, maintaining compliance trackers and providing business requirements for system updates.
  • Cross-Functional Collaboration: Collaborate with Human Resources Service Delivery, Employee Relations, Payroll, and external administrators to ensure accurate policy execution, resolve complex escalated cases, and establish clear standard operating procedures.

What You’ll Bring

The ideal candidate will have:

  • 3-5+ years of progressive, hands-on experience in retirement and leave benefit plan and policy design.

  • Strong knowledge of United States and Canadian benefit programs, including Family and Medical Leave Act, Paid Family and Medical Leave, Short-Term Disability, and Long-Term Disability regulations.
  • Advanced Data Mastery: Proven capability in aggregating, manipulating, and analyzing complex data sets, census files, and intricate plan documents.
  • Technical Expertise: Strong, practical proficiency in Workday and ServiceNow platforms is highly preferred.
  • Strategic Agility: Exceptional skills in business case development, negotiation, stakeholder relationship management, and influencing outcomes within a matrixed corporate structure.
  • Communication Skills: Professional fluency in written and verbal English, with a proven ability to present actionable, data-driven insights to executive leadership.
